Can I Buy Bitcoin Through Ameritrade?

In the rapidly evolving world of cryptocurrencies, many individuals are looking for ways to invest in Bitcoin and other digital currencies. One of the most common questions that arise is whether it is possible to buy Bitcoin through Ameritrade. In this article, we will explore this question and provide you with all the necessary information to make an informed decision.
Firstly, it is important to note that Ameritrade, now known as TD Ameritrade, is a well-established brokerage firm that offers a wide range of financial services, including stock trading, options trading, and mutual funds. However, when it comes to cryptocurrencies, Ameritrade has a different approach.
As of now, Ameritrade does not offer direct trading of Bitcoin or other cryptocurrencies. This means that you cannot directly buy Bitcoin through Ameritrade's platform. However, there are alternative ways to invest in Bitcoin through Ameritrade, which we will discuss later in this article.
One of the primary reasons why Ameritrade does not offer direct Bitcoin trading is due to regulatory restrictions. Cryptocurrencies are still a relatively new and highly speculative asset class, and regulatory bodies around the world are still working on establishing clear guidelines for their trading and investment. As a result, many traditional brokerage firms, including Ameritrade, have chosen to steer clear of direct cryptocurrency trading to avoid potential legal and regulatory issues.
Despite not offering direct Bitcoin trading, Ameritrade does provide investors with the opportunity to invest in Bitcoin indirectly through certain exchange-traded funds (ETFs) and other financial instruments. One such option is the ProShares Bitcoin Strategy ETF (BITO), which tracks the price of Bitcoin and allows investors to gain exposure to the cryptocurrency market without owning the actual Bitcoin.
To invest in BITO or any other cryptocurrency-related ETF through Ameritrade, you will need to follow these steps:
1. Open an account with Ameritrade if you don't already have one.
2. Log in to your Ameritrade account and navigate to the "ETFs" section.
3. Use the search function to find the cryptocurrency ETF you are interested in, such as BITO.
4. Once you find the ETF, click on it to view its details and click "Buy" to purchase shares.
It is important to note that investing in cryptocurrency-related ETFs does not provide the same level of direct exposure to the Bitcoin market as owning the actual cryptocurrency. However, it can be a more accessible and regulated way to gain exposure to the cryptocurrency market.
In conclusion, while Ameritrade does not offer direct Bitcoin trading, investors can still gain exposure to the cryptocurrency market through alternative investment options such as cryptocurrency-related ETFs. It is essential to conduct thorough research and consider the risks associated with investing in cryptocurrencies before making any investment decisions. So, can I buy Bitcoin through Ameritrade? The answer is not a direct purchase, but there are indirect ways to invest in the cryptocurrency market through Ameritrade.
